  • 7. 70M tweets per day = 800 tweets per second
  • 9. How big are they? 1 tweet text = 140 characters ≈ 200 bytes
  • 10. 800 tweets per second ≈ 160 KB/sec ≈ 9 MB/min ≈ 12 GB/day Just tweet text!
  • 11. MySQL Can’t generate IDs fast enough Centralized and a single point of failure snowflake Highly available and uncoordinated (10kqps) Compatible with the ecosystem http://github.com/twitter/snowflake

  • 18. Photo used under Creative Commons from jurvetson Distributed graph database flockdb High rate of CRUD operations Complex set arithmetic queries http://github.com/twitter/flockdb

  • 20. How do they get out? 6B API calls per day ≈ 70,000 calls per second
  • 21. REST API XML/JSON API over HTTP Poll-based system / pseudo real-time hosebird Streaming API Long poll HTTP Near real-time delivery of Tweets
  • 24. Where do we want to be? Today - 150M people generate ~1000 TPS Tomorrow - we want to support half the world and all its devices (5B phones and 6B people)
